Direct Certification Improvement Grants FY15: Direct Certification Improvement Grants
FNS invites State agencies that administer NSLP and SBP to apply for a Direct Certification Improvement Grant to fund the costs of improving their direct certification rates with the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) and other assistance programs, as allowed under Federal statute and regulations.

Under this RFA, approximately $4.5 million is available for grants to NSLP State agencies to fund direct certification improvement projects.

Two types of Direct Certification Improvement Grants are available:
1) Tier 1 grants for up to $150,000 for limited-scope planning and implementation projects, and

2) Tier 2 grants for up to $1,000,000 for full-scope implementation projects. States may apply for either a Tier 1 or a Tier 2 grant, but not both under this RFA solicitation. Application submission due dates include: July 15, 2015; October 15, 2015; January 15, 2016; April 15, 2016; and July 15, 2016.
